What is API Testing?
API testing is a crucial component of software testing that focuses on testing the APIs directly, rather than the GUI. It helps in ensuring that the APIs are functioning correctly and are delivering the expected results. API testing is essential for validating the performance, security, and functionality of APIs.
Why is API Testing Important?
- Early Detection of Issues: API testing allows for the early detection of issues, making it easier to address them before they impact the end-user.
- Non-UI Testing: It helps in testing the functionality of APIs without relying on the GUI, which is crucial for web services.
- Performance Testing: API testing enables performance testing to ensure that APIs can handle the expected load.
Top API Testing Frameworks
1. Postman
Overview: Postman is a powerful API client that is widely used for API testing. It allows users to create and execute tests, validate responses, and monitor the performance of APIs.
Key Features: - Easy to Use Interface: Postman offers an intuitive interface that makes it easy for users to create and execute tests. - Collection Management: Users can organize tests into collections, making it easier to manage and share them. - Integration with CI/CD Tools: Postman can be integrated with CI/CD tools for automated testing.
2. SoapUI
Overview: SoapUI is a popular API testing tool that supports both SOAP and REST APIs. It offers a comprehensive suite of features for testing, monitoring, and analyzing APIs.
Key Features: - Support for Multiple Protocols: SoapUI supports a wide range of protocols, including SOAP, REST, GraphQL, and more. - Load Testing: It provides load testing capabilities to simulate real-world usage scenarios. - Integration with JIRA and Selenium: SoapUI can be integrated with JIRA and Selenium for advanced testing scenarios.
3. Apigee
Overview: Apigee is an API management platform that provides comprehensive API testing capabilities. It allows users to test APIs in a secure, sandbox environment.
Key Features: - Sandbox Environment: Apigee provides a secure sandbox environment for testing APIs without impacting the production environment. - Integration with CI/CD: Apigee can be integrated with CI/CD tools for automated testing. - Advanced Analytics: It offers advanced analytics to help users understand the performance and usage patterns of their APIs.
